Output 0d5c3fabf541ae4e29ebffcc79f6f8801925b0f64c0eb6a0544bc011192cbbd0:0

value
9414271
script pubkey
OP_0 OP_PUSHBYTES_20 40e37433474825cb3e51001a891a256dd787e6c9
address
bc1qgr3hgv68fqjuk0j3qqdgjx39dhtc0ekfu5de3x
transaction
0d5c3fabf541ae4e29ebffcc79f6f8801925b0f64c0eb6a0544bc011192cbbd0
confirmations
88631
spent
true